Nintendo of America president and chief operating officer Doug Bowser will retire Dec. 31 after more than a decade at the company.
He will be succeeded by Devon Pritchard, a nearly a 20-year veteran of the video game industry and long-time Nintendo exec. Most recently, Pritchard served as executive vice president of revenue, marketing and consumer experience at Nintendo of America , overseeing many aspects of the Switch 2 launch this spring. Pritchard will also join the Nintendo of America board of directors and become an executive officer at Japan-based parent company Nintendo.
Additionally, Satoru Shibata will join Nintendo of America as CEO, while continuing his roles as managing executive officer and corporate director and member of the board at Nintendo.
